/cs2-Bot-Quota-GoldKingZ

Kick/Add Bots Depend How Many Players In The Server

Primary LanguageC#

.:[ Join Our Discord For Support ]:.


[CS2] Bot-Quota-GoldKingZ (1.0.1)

Kick / Add Bots Depend How Many Players In The Server

.:[ Dependencies ]:.

Metamod:Source (2.x)

CounterStrikeSharp

Newtonsoft.Json

.:[ Configuration ]:.

Caution

Config Located In ..\addons\counterstrikesharp\plugins\Bot-Quota-GoldKingZ\config\config.json

{
  //Disable Plugin On WarmUp?
  "DisablePluginOnWarmUp": false,

  //Check Players By Timer?
  "CheckPlayersByTimer": true,

  //Added Bots When 5 Or Less Players In The Server
  "AddBotsWhenXOrLessPlayersInServer": 5,

  //Do You Want Spec Players Count With AddBotsWhenXOrLessPlayersInServer?
  //true = Yes
  //false = No Exclude Them From Counting
  "IncludeCountingSpecPlayers": true,

  //How Many Bots Should Add When AddBotsWhenXOrLessPlayersInServer Happens
  "HowManyBotsShouldAdd": 10,

  //Add Bot By Mode? (normal,fill,match)
  "BotAddMode": "fill",

  //Exec cfg When Bots Added (Note Need cfg To Be Inside csgo/cfg/) Note: Make It Empty "" To Disable
  //Example : Bot-Quota-GoldKingZ/WhenBotsAdded.cfg 
  "ExecConfigWhenBotsAdded": "",

  //Exec cfg When Bots Kicked (Note Need cfg To Be Inside csgo/cfg/) Note: Make It Empty "" To Disable
  //Example : Bot-Quota-GoldKingZ/WhenBotsKicked.cfg 
  "ExecConfigWhenBotsKicked": "",

//----------------------------[ ↓ Debug ↓ ]----------------------------

  //Enable Debug Will Print Server Console If You Face Any Issue
  "EnableDebug": false,
}

329846165-ba02c700-8e0b-4ebe-bc28-103b796c0b2e

.:[ Language ]:.

{
	//==========================
	//        Colors
	//==========================
	//{Yellow} {Gold} {Silver} {Blue} {DarkBlue} {BlueGrey} {Magenta} {LightRed}
	//{LightBlue} {Olive} {Lime} {Red} {Purple} {Grey}
	//{Default} {White} {Darkred} {Green} {LightYellow}
	//==========================
	//        Other
	//==========================
	//{nextline} = Print On Next Line
	//{0} = How Many Bots Added
	//{1} = Players Counts
	//==========================
	
    "PrintChatToAll.LessPlayers": "{green}Gold KingZ {grey}| {grey}Server Has Less Players {lime}Adding {0} Bots",
    "PrintChatToAll.KickBots": "{green}Gold KingZ {grey}| {grey}Server Has More Players {darkred}Kicking All Bots"
}

.:[ Change Log ]:.

(1.0.1)
-Fix Bug

(1.0.0)
-Initial Release

.:[ Donation ]:.

If this project help you reduce time to develop, you can give me a cup of coffee :)

paypal